After Calling For Bipartisanship, Pelosi Won’t Rule Out Investigating Trump

December 1, 2018 Chris Donaldson
 

As Nancy Pelosi gets closer to regaining the mighty gavel as Speaker Of The House she is backing away from anything that even remotely resembles bipartisanship as Democrats prepare to launch dozens of investigations into President Trump.

Now that she has been formally nominated for the speakership, Pelosi is hedging on her post-election vows of a new era of “bipartisanship and common ground” that she expressed in a press conference in early November and threw in with the lynch mob that has been itching to prosecute their dirty war on Trump.

During another presser on Friday, Pelosi joined several incoming Democrats and sent a signal of what’s to come and it isn’t likely to be governing in the best interests of the American people.
